I love thinking about the lab instructions for this knitted biology project: “Okay now find the mesentary and the pancreas…use your scapel to cast on, and then your number 5 needle to lift up the purled oviducts.”   “aKNITomy makes these darling hand-knit dissected frogs with needle-felted guts. They’re mounted in aluminum dissection trays. Titled “Knitting in Biology 101,” they’re available in the Boing Boing Bazaar for $125.” And in case it looks too gross, these yarn x-eyes remind you that you CAN’T actually smell the formaldehyde.
